Disability shower installation services involve customizing bathroom showers to accommodate individuals with mobility challenges or other disabilities. These installations often include features such as low-threshold or curbless entryways, grab bars, seating options, and non-slip flooring to enhance safety and accessibility. The goal is to create a bathing environment that allows for independence and ease of use, reducing the risk of slips and falls while providing comfort for users with varying needs.
This service addresses common problems faced by those with limited mobility, such as difficulty stepping over high tub edges or maneuvering in standard showers. By installing accessible shower setups, property owners can mitigate safety hazards and improve overall functionality. For caregivers and family members, these modifications can also ease daily routines and reduce the need for assistance, promoting dignity and independence for individuals with disabilities or aging-related mobility issues.

Installation Costs - The typical cost for installing a disability shower ranges from $1,500 to $4,000, depending on the complexity and materials used. Basic models tend to be on the lower end, while customized solutions can increase the price. Local service providers can offer detailed estimates based on specific needs.
Material Expenses - Materials for disability showers usually cost between $300 and $1,200, with options like accessible tiles, grab bars, and waterproofing materials influencing the price. Higher-end finishes or specialized features may raise material costs further. Local contractors can help identify suitable options within budget.
Labor Fees - Labor charges for installing a disability shower typically range from $700 to $2,500, influenced by the project's scope and site conditions. More intricate installations or modifications to existing bathrooms may increase labor costs. Contact local pros for precise quotes tailored to the installation.
Additional Expenses - Extra costs such as permits, plumbing modifications, or custom features can add $200 to $1,000 or more. These expenses vary based on local regulations and specific installation requirements. Service providers can advise on potential additional costs for each project.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
